Glassdoor users rated their interview experience at Simplybiz as 75% positive with a difficulty rating score of 2.25 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ty). Candidates interviewing for Data Entry and Advisor product administrator rated their interviews as the hardest, whereas interviews for Compliance and Data Administrator roles were rated as the easiest.
The hiring process at Simplybiz takes an average of 2 days when considering 4 user submitted interviews across all job titles. Candidates applying for Compliance had the quickest hiring process (on average 2 days), whereas Compliance roles had the slowest hiring process (on average 2 days).

I applied for a data entry role, got contacted by someone from the recruitment team, and was asked to complete a form and send it back. I did this in the 1st hour and was notified that I will get some sort of response in a week's time. After a week of no response, I contacted the recruitment person back. When I asked for an update regarding my application I got a very blunt response that their managers are very busy and if I don't like I can withdrawal my application. I said no, I still wish to continue of course that's why I applied in the 1st place. It's been 4 weeks almost now and no response.
No response whatsoever, find It very unprofessional to ask a candidate to answers questions on a form that took a bit of time... and after 4 weeks not to get ANY response whatsoever.
I was very disappointed about this, as it only takes anyone a few seconds just to reply that I didn't make the cut. If you set the expectation that you will provide a response in a week, and then after 4 weeks time still no answer this means to me that the recruitment team cannot spare 30 seconds to compose a message back to me saying, hey you didn't get the role, thanks for your time.
But no, no communication from the moment I was asked to complete the form of the questions.
